Docsity
Docsity

Prepara i tuoi esami
Prepara i tuoi esami

Studia grazie alle numerose risorse presenti su Docsity


Ottieni i punti per scaricare
Ottieni i punti per scaricare

Guadagna punti aiutando altri studenti oppure acquistali con un piano Premium


Guide e consigli
Guide e consigli


Introduzione alla Programmazione in Java: Concetti Fondamentali e Esempi, Appunti di Fondamenti di informatica

Appunti università della calabria - ingegneria informatica

Tipologia: Appunti

2018/2019

In vendita dal 12/10/2019

erty89qs
erty89qs 🇮🇹

4.5

(6)

42 documenti

1 / 10

Toggle sidebar

Questa pagina non è visibile nell’anteprima

Non perderti parti importanti!

bg1
BYTECODE5
programmata class
Hello
World.jo I
Fa.IE Eiifle
java VIRTUAL MACHINE
Write Once
Run Anywhere Interprete di Java
Esegue programmi
nel linguaggio macchina
di Java
ti
PRO ll Hardware
lo stesso codice può essere eseguito su
diverse piattaforme
CONTRO Minore Velocità
pf3
pf4
pf5
pf8
pf9
pfa

Anteprima parziale del testo

Scarica Introduzione alla Programmazione in Java: Concetti Fondamentali e Esempi e più Appunti in PDF di Fondamenti di informatica solo su Docsity!

BYTECODE 5

programmataHello class

World.jo

I Fa.IE (^) Eiifle java VIRTUAL^ MACHINE Write Once

Run Anywhere

Interprete di Java Esegue (^) programmi nel linguaggio macchina di (^) Java t i PRO ll Hardware lo (^) stesso codice può essere (^) eseguito su diverse piattaforme CONTRO Minore^ Velocità

Java ha^ molti^ benefici della

compilazione ed i

benefici

della interpretazione E un^ linguaggio Tipped Occorre (^) dichiarare in modo preciso il

tipo

di ogni variabile int

flaaty

s.at

i t

SOLO (^) anche DICHIARAZIONE X assegnarne inizializzazione syazm.out.net DÌ

int x^3 int y 5 short (^2 2) il (^) contenuto di 7 reiene z promosso 1 ad int À ed (^) assegnatoad 2 short

y y

cast (^) esplicito chiediamo al^ compilatore di trattare^ y come (^) se fosse una^ ricaricabile short class (^) Serve (^) a definire oggetti Il file HelloWorld forza

public

class (^) Hall World 2

public

stette (^) void main

stringe orge

System out^ print Hello (^) World

class serve^ a definire Di proprietà (^) nuovi oggetti

Maja

È Igiene

privateering matricola^

private fleeing nome tifi I μ Listaesami esami di ciascuno e a a studente

time

Naomi aggiungi Esame Esame È p so a^ Erano

che funzioni

e

SINTASSI DELLE FUNZIONI JAVA

public

stette int^ massima^ Cinta

i

t

t

t

visibilità

tipo

del nome parametri vialone proprietà editrici formali della classe e non^ degli oggetti della (^) classe

CICLI while condition Blocco (^) Istruzioni tfe.IE eo eseguito da

finché

la Blocco condizione è while condizione^ true

ARRAY

lunghezza inteso new^ intero^1 dell'array À

o fissata

intesa a (^0) l 19 0 Viene

eseguita prima si^ ripete

il dell'inizio del^ far blocco

finché

t è (^) ten for

Istruzione Condizione Istruzione

Blocco L viene (^) eseguita al termine di ogni iterazione dopo Blocco

BUBBLE (^) SORT

qui

giu i (^11) Numero (^) confrontinel^ caso^ peggiore N N^1 N^2 In Ad ogni iterazione l'elemento^ più grande si muove verso^ la^ fine (^) dell'array La posizione

dell'ultimo scambio

individua un punto al (^) di (^) là del quale l'array

è certamente ordinato

Il codice è^ sulla^ piattaforma ESERCI ZIO

Abbiamo svolto il 2 esercizio della

i traccia (^) del modulo^1 ti (^) e (^1 2 3 4 5 6 7) appello (^41441284 ) Il prodotto (^) degli μ indice^ diequilibrio elementi che^ lo^ precedono prodpprendene è ugual al (^) prodotto (^) degli prodruccanirei elementi che lo^ seguono Il codice è^ sulla